What is the fatpirate app and how does it work?

The fatpirate app is a mobile‑first casino platform that brings a full‑scale gambling experience straight to your iPhone or Android. It bundles slots, live casino tables and a modest sportsbook under one roof, all licensed by the UK Gambling Commission.

When you launch the app, you’re greeted by a clean dashboard where you can deposit, claim bonuses or jump straight into a live dealer game. The software uses HTML5 and native code, meaning the graphics load quickly even on 3G connections. For UK players, the app respects local regulations – you’ll see responsible‑gambling tools and clear information about wagering requirements on every promotion.

Signing up: registration and verification steps

Getting started is intentionally simple. Tap “Sign Up” on the home screen, then fill in your email, a password and your date of birth. The app will ask for a postcode to confirm you’re based in the United Kingdom – this is part of the licence check.

After you confirm your email, a short KYC (Know Your Customer) process follows. You’ll need to upload a photo ID and a recent utility bill. The verification usually finishes within an hour, though occasional peak times can stretch it to 24 hours. Once approved, your account is ready for deposits and you can claim the welcome bonus.

Bonuses and promotions – what you can claim on the app

The fatpirate app offers a welcome bonus split across your first two deposits – typically 100 % up to £200 plus 50 free spins. The catch is a 30x wagering requirement on the bonus amount, which is pretty standard for UK‑licensed casinos.

Beyond the welcome package, the app runs weekly reload bonuses, cash‑back on losses and a “Pirate’s Treasure” loyalty scheme where you earn points for every £10 wagered. Points can be swapped for bonus credit or free spins. All promotions are clearly listed in the “Promotions” tab, with expiry dates and wagering terms displayed upfront.

Payment methods, deposits and withdrawal speed

Depositing on the fatpirate app is straightforward. You can use Visa, Mastercard, PayPal, Skrill, and the newer “Pay by Bank” instant transfer. Most deposits are processed instantly, letting you start playing within seconds.

Withdrawals are a little slower, mainly because of anti‑fraud checks. The typical processing time is 24‑48 hours for e‑wallets and up to five working days for bank transfers. The minimum withdrawal is £10, and there’s a £5 fee for withdrawals under £100 via bank transfer. The app shows a clear “Withdrawal History” page where you can track the status of each request.</
